Doctors diagnose asthma with the same tests used to identify the disease in adults. Spirometry measures how much air your child can exhale and how quickly. Your child might have lung function tests at rest, after exercising and after taking asthma medication. Another lung function test is brochoprovocation. See more Asthma can be hard to diagnose. Your child's doctor will consider the symptoms and their frequency and your child's medical history.
